Ahead of carrying out a loft conversion, we had some concern that our existing water pressure would not cope with the additional bathrooms we were having made. After reading reviews about Billy Hunter on edf I called him and he took his time to give me some good advice on how to improve water pressure. We decided to pick Billy for the job. He installed an unvented cylinder for us and upgraded our pipework. I also agree with other reviewers that he went over and above expectations by pointing out and fixing other plumbing issues unrelated to the task at hand. (For us, it was that the boiler flue installed was not positioned to regulation distance). We were really happy with the job Billy did and wouldn't hesitate to seek out his services again. -

I just had F&E joinery install 4 new double glazed sashes for my Victorian property. I got burned a couple of years ago by some window fitters I found on MyBuilder who, while were the most price competitive, did not do the best installation. F&E joinery were a pleasure to work with. They were easy to reach by email and once I placed the order, they were able to deliver the windows within 4 weeks which suited my tight time scales. They only spent 2 1/2 days on site and were very tidy at home. The windows look great and the installations ran seamlessly. My only minor qualm is that I thought their quote for painting the woodwork prior to installation was too high, therefore I decided to use a local painter to do the paint work post installation instead. -
